Honda NTV 650 Revere - 1992 Specifications and Reviews
The 1992 Honda NTV 650 Revere is a versatile middleweight naked bike that appeals to riders seeking comfortable, practical everyday transportation. Known for its reliable V-twin engine and shaft drive, it delivers smooth performance with excellent fuel efficiency. Its upright riding position and manageable power output make it ideal for both commuting and weekend riding.

Engine and Transmission Specifications | |
| Transmission type,final drive | Shaft drive (cardan) |
| Gearbox | 5-speed |
| Cooling system | Liquid |
| Fuel control | OHC |
| Valves per cylinder | 3 |
| Bore x stroke | 79.0 x 66.0 mm (3.1 x 2.6 inches) |
| Compression | 9.2:1 |
| Power | 60.00 |
| Engine type | V2, four-stroke |
| Capacity: | 647.00 ccm (39.48 cubic inches) |

Brakes, suspension, Frame and wheels | |
| Rear brakes | Single disc |
| Front brakes | Single disc |
| Rear tyre dimensions | 150/70-17 |
| Front tyre dimensions | 110/80-17 |
Physical measures and capacities | |
| Fuel capacity | 19.00 litres (5.02 gallons) |
| Weight incl. oil, gas, etc | 208.0 kg (458.6 pounds) |
